About Ingo Blum
Ingo Blum is an author, graphic designer, and comedian. He has always enjoyed projects where he could create artwork for kids. Eventually, he became a writer and graphic designer and started writing children's stories to accompany these projects for fun. With some encouragement from his friends and family (and a lot of kids!), he decided to share his stories with the world. Ingo works with illustrators from all over the world with whom he constantly develops new concepts and stories.

Two Verions Of Japanese:
This book is for bilingual language learning. It is edited in two versions. Considerations in the editing are following differences between English and Japanese grammar.
Pronouns (I, you, he, she, me, him, her, etc.) are often dropped in the subject and/or object as well as in the possessive form in Japanese.There are different verb forms: polite, simple, dictionary form, etc., besides verb conjugations.
Finally, there are sentence-ending particles to convey nuances.In the text, the first line in bold letters uses children’s language, which is not generally taught in Japanese learning books. The second line in smaller letters includes pronouns and uses a polite form which is typically taught in Japanese language textbooks.
For all kids learning English or Japanese as a second language.
